Egyptian Ambassador Visits NDMA, Commits to Supporting Disaster Management Efforts in Sierra Leone

NDMA’s Headquarters, Aberdeen, Freetown- 1st October 2025 – The National Disaster Management Agency (NDMA) on Monday, 29th September 2025, hosted Her Excellency Rasha Soliman Mohieldin Soliman, Ambassador of the Arab Republic of Egypt to Sierra Leone, in a courtesy visit aimed at familiarizing herself with the agency’s work and exploring possible partnerships to strengthen disaster management in the country.

The NDMA Director General, Lit. Gen. (Rtd) Brima Sesay welcomed Ambassador Soliman and her delegation. In his remarks, he commended the Ambassador’s initiative to familiarize herself with the work of the agency, emphasizing that partnerships and international collaboration are pivotal to building Sierra Leone’s resilience to disasters.


NDMA’s Deputy Director of Regional Operations, Gerald King, gave a detailed presentation on the agency’s operations. He highlighted NDMA’s core mandates, ranging from disaster prevention and preparedness to emergency response and post-disaster recovery. Mr. King also pointed to persistent challenges the agency faces such as limited resources, the growing effects of climate change, and the urgent need for stronger technical and financial support.

Director of Relief and Response at the NDMA, Sinneh Mansaray also shared insights on the diverse types of disasters Sierra Leone faces annually. These include seasonal floods, fire outbreaks, windstorms, landslides, and health-related emergencies, all of which he said disproportionately impact vulnerable communities.

In response, Ambassador Soliman committed to seeking opportunities to support the agency, particularly in the areas of capacity building, early warning systems, and emergency response. She assured the NDMA that she would maintain close contact with the agency to follow up on these areas of potential collaboration.

In closing, NDMA’s Gender Focal Person, Mrs. Erica Konneh, thanked the Ambassador on behalf of the agency. She expressed profound gratitude to her for her engagement and reaffirmed NDMA’s commitment to deepening collaboration with Egypt in advancing disaster preparedness and response initiatives.
